I had the privilege of celebrating Easter weekend with my family at Lake Hartwell.  While on the lake we discovered an area that I called a tree graveyard.  Out of the calm still waters, trees emerged. Probably underwater a safe haven for fish, although some fisherman were willing to navigate the dangerous area for a chance of a big catch. But as I looked out I saw danger for our boat, an area of land blocked off and evidence of a time past.  A time before the lake was formed and trees grew over the land.  A time when as God intended trees filled this place.  A time when people wouldn't think of these trees as danger but only God's beauty here on earth.
